We bring the same passion to our institutional retirement business, partnering with companies to mitigate pension risk and ensure the financial future of their annuitants with our financial strength and market leading customer service.The Senior Financial Analyst plays a critical role in the Company's US Cost Control Team. This position is responsible for coordinating and monitoring budgets, re-forecasting, and analysis of operating expenses. This individual will develop, interpret, and implement financial concepts for financial planning and control. In addition, they will be expected to perform analysis to determine present and future financial performance.The Senior Financial Analyst will work on a hybrid basis in our Stamford, CT or Frederick, MD office. Full-time remote option will be considered based on experience and proven ability to work from home successfully.Responsibilities

Expense Planning and Forecasting:Collaborate with various business partners to produce and analyze an annual operating expense plan including monthly forecasts and updates.Prepare and analyze variance analysis and explanations between plan, actuals, and reforecasts. Ensure sound operational decisions are made by providing financial analysis that considers these items and the implications to P&L statements.Perform analysis of data trends on budget spend to enable teams/business areas to meet key performance indicators (internal and external focused).Communicate cost risks and opportunities for various business areas/cost centers and make recommendations to the finance leadership team.Support preparation of plan presentations.Understand financial models to forecast results.Expense Management:Prepare expense and intercompany reconciliations.Compile a comprehensive analysis package for monthly review.Actively identify outstanding expenses and ensure accrual completeness.Assist team with procurement process & inquiries on travel expenses/invoice processing.Analyze expense data and act as a subject matter authority to provide additional insights.Support cost center allocations process for IFRS 17 and local STAT reporting.Maintain and update organization wide expense study results.Other Responsibilities:Support ad hoc requests.Assist in the preparation of monthly management information, including management reports, Board decks, Performance metrics monitoring and other reporting.Support setting business requirements, testing and implementation of new digital finance solutions (new tools, automation/AI initiatives/projects, etc).Seek opportunities for operational improvements and efficiencies.Perform other assignments/special projects as needed.Travel to Maryland office expected if full time remote (approximately

Qualifications

Education:BA/BS with major/concentration in a business and/or quantitative discipline, e.g., Finance and Accounting.Certified Public Accountant (CPA), Certified Financial Analyst (CFA) or MBA a plus, but not necessary.Experience/Knowledge:4+ years in a finance, accounting, actuarial, or strategy role, preferably within the life insurance industry, including 2+ years in financial planning/budgeting.Skills:Strong financial acumen, with financial planning/reporting background.Excellent interpersonal skills, including the ability to collaborate with colleagues at all levels of the organization.Strong time management and organizational skills, with the ability to lead several tasks accurately with a high level of initiative and integrity.Strong written and oral communication skills.Demonstrated ability to work independently and establish priorities to meet tight deadlines.Detail-oriented while still being able to see the big picture.Proven adaptability when working with changing deliverables.Familiarity with accounting principles is helpful, but not necessary.Advanced proficiency with Excel, PowerPoint, Power BI and databases a must.Proficiency in programming (SQL, Python) or AI exposure/experience considered a plus.Finance Transformation experience is a plus.Organizational Structure:Reports To:

Finance Manager, US Cost ControlWhat's in it for you?

The expected hiring compensation range for this position is $88,300 - $121,375 annually. Candidates within a commutable distance to Stamford, CT or Frederick, MD will receive preference. The total compensation package for this position may include other elements, such as a sign-on bonus, long term incentives, and annual bonuses. This role is eligible to participate in the Legal & General America Annual Incentive Plan. The current target payment for the position is 8% of base salary, modified for corporate and individual performance. Bonuses are pro-rated based on start date. This role has 15 vacation days and 10 sick days that are accrued on a bi-weekly basis. Employees also have 9 paid holidays throughout the calendar year.We have a competitive compensation and benefits package focused on your overall wellbeing. Employee benefits include health, life, and dental insurance; 401K with company match up to 6%; generous time off; and wellbeing initiatives throughout the year.
